删除Python中的EXIF数据?

时间:2014-02-19 18:55:36

标签: python exif

是否有任何python库/简单的方法从JPEG中剥离EXIF数据而不会对性能/图像质量产生显着影响?我搜索了一个但找不到多少。我正在托管一些用户上传图片,并且出于隐私/安全原因想剥离这些数据。

由于

2 个答案:

答案 0 :(得分:1)

image = GExiv2.Metadata('sample.jpg')
image.clear_exif()
image.clear_xmp()
image.save_file()

使用gexiv2库:https://wiki.gnome.org/Projects/gexiv2

答案 1 :(得分:1)

万一有人在寻找现有的(python)实现或更多功能的更高级解决方案,这里有Metadata Anonymization Toolkit的链接。

查看images.py file可能会很有趣,其中包含有用的信息。